TURN-208: Gatevale turnstile counters at the Merrow Field pilot double-count when a rotation reverses mid-cycle. Attendance totals drift roughly 2% high per event. The debounce window fix is implemented, reviewed by Ilsa, and soak-tested across two simulated match days without drift. Ready for your cut; the candidate build is identified below.

trace token, tagag-tafog: htk6_5ed18c

Handover: Exportron retry queue

Hi Mira — handing over the failed-export retries. Exports that hit a timeout land in the retry queue and get three attempts with backoff; after that they're parked and need a manual requeue from the admin panel. Watch for customers reporting duplicates — that usually means a double requeue. The current retry settings are as follows.

settings of bajog-fawig:
oliael:
  log_level: warn
  metrics_host: metrics.oliael.zemvarsys.internal
  pin: 0267
  pool_size: 32

Hey — handing off the Quillbuild hermetic migration. Most targets build clean now; the codegen step is the last holdout since it reaches for system headers. Pin everything through the toolchain manifest and it behaves. Future maintainers: the build service currently runs with the configuration shown below.

deployment values, fahap-hahaf:
[casdor]
port = 9200
region = south-2
host = casdor.qirvanworks.corp
timeout_ms = 3000
retries = 4

## Order Cutoff Rule

Crumbline enforces a hard order cutoff so the Oakhollow bakery kitchen can plan morning production. Orders placed after the configured cutoff roll to the next fulfillment day; the rule lives in `cutoff/rules.py` and is evaluated in the shop's local timezone, never UTC. Reviewers should confirm any change keeps `CUTOFF_HOUR` and `CUTOFF_GRACE_MIN` consistent with the values in the staging env file. That file also holds the ordering API's signing secret, which sits on the line directly after this sentence.

env line for fafof-fahag: LEDGER_TOKEN5=f8790

## Profile Store Sharding: Limits & Quotas

Heads up, plugin folks: the Bramblewick profile store shards by user-id hash, and each shard has hard ceilings you can't negotiate around. Exceeding a write quota gets your plugin throttled, not queued. Keep batch sizes modest and retry with backoff. Current per-shard defaults are as follows.

constants for bawif-kawif:
QUOTAS = {
    "ulaael": 5,
    "holael": 10,
}